You will be able to dump it if you want. When people say they cant lower the car that much, its because they are lowereing it like they would if they were using GCs or Skunk2 coilovers. These omnis use that similar design to handle the preloading of the spring ONLY. DO NOT lower the car from these collars and you should be able to dump it real low. You lower it by using the very bottom collar and twisting the shock body itself. Again, DO NOT lower the car using the upper two collars.

what function motoring was saying is true. your only supposed to drop by the lower perch area, but it some wierd cases (mine), you must use SOME (meaning only 1/8th an inch) of the spring preloaded area to fully drop your car. I did the whole lower perch thing ALL THE WAY, till i ran out of threading and the shock bottom was hitting the a-arm ALMOST. I emailed omni, and they never got back to me, so i just decided to lower it using the normal way for skunks or gc's.

the ride is fine, and i dont think they (the shocks) will bottom out since they are short travel. I along with my others (so it seems by reading on here) have this wierd problem. I dunno why the back coilovers have sooo much room (meaning threading and length) to be dropped another 2 inches probably from what i have mine set at, and the fronts are maxxed out using the bottom lowering technique, and some of the top way.

doesnt make sense. none-the-lesss, they dont bottom out, and handle very very well which is what they were intented to do for a good price.
